Property Overview: 61 Moore Avenue, Winnipeg
Key Characteristics & Appeal
This 1,040 sqft bungalow, built in 1967, presents a solid, middle-of-the-road offering in Winnipeg's Pulberry neighborhood. Its primary appeal lies in its balance and established context. The home sits on a 5,963 sqft lot that is notably larger than many city-wide averages, offering good outdoor space potential. While the living area is slightly below the neighborhood average, it is competitive for the street itself, suggesting the home fits comfortably within its immediate surroundings.
The assessed value of $386k is consistently "around average" at every comparison level—street, neighborhood, and city. This indicates a property that is priced squarely within the market norm, not overvalued for its area nor a standout bargain. A thoughtful perspective is that this consistency can be a strength for a cautious buyer; it represents a known quantity with less risk of pricing anomalies. The home would suit a first-time buyer or downsizer looking for a manageable, single-story layout in a mature area, or an investor seeking a stable, average-value asset without extreme fluctuations.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How does this home's size compare to others nearby?
At 1,040 sqft, the living area is very close to the average for Moore Avenue itself but is somewhat smaller than the broader Pulberry neighborhood average. This suggests the home is typical for its specific street.
2. Is the assessed value reasonable for the area?
Yes. The $386k assessment is consistently around the average benchmark when compared to similar homes on the street, in Pulberry, and across Winnipeg, indicating it is fairly aligned with the market.
3. What is the significance of the lot size?
The lot of 5,963 sqft is above the city-wide average. On Moore Avenue, it ranks in the top 30% for size, which is a positive differentiator, offering more yard space than many comparable properties.
4. When was it last sold, and for how much?
The home was sold in November 2016. The public data shows a sold price range of CA$300k–350k. For verified, exact historical sale figures, you can request a manual lookup from the site.
5. How does the age of the home (1967) compare?
Built in 1967, this home is newer than the average house on Moore Avenue, ranking in the top 20% for year built on the street. It is very close to the average age for both the neighborhood and the city.
